LOADING...
Faça login e
comente
Usuário ou Email
Senha
Esqueceu sua senha?
Ou
Registrar e
publicar
Você está quase pronto! Agora definir o seu nome de usuário e senha.
Usuário
Email
Senha
Senha
» Anuncie » Envie uma dica Ei, você é um redator, programador ou web designer? Estamos contratando!

Use o Windows Device Recovery Tool para reinstalar manualmente o firmware de seu Lumia [tutorial]

08 de julho de 2016 36

Há algum tempo publicamos um tutorial explicando a maneira mais prática para alterar manualmente o firmware de um smartphone da linha Lumia, algo útil na época devido à incrível demora na disponibilização do update Lumia Denim em nosso país, o que fez muita gente recorrer a este método para "migrar" seu aparelho para uma região onde a atualização já estivesse disponível. Como vimos de uns tempos pra cá, a Microsoft resolveu tomar as rédeas do canal de updates no Windows 10 Mobile, puxando para si até mesmo a responsabilidade pela liberação de um firmware atualizados para os aparelhos, algo que infelizmente não acontece há bastante tempo para quem possui modelos que partiram do WIndows Phone 8.1.

Pensando nisso, resolvemos publicar uma versão atualizada do tutorial para instalação manual de firmware, já que o método utilizado anteriormente não é compatível com dispositivos lançados após o primeiro semestre de 2014, deixando assim de fora todos os smartphones da linha Lumia sob a marca da Microsoft. Com a alteração do firmware, você poderá não apenas se livrar de versões vinculadas à operadoras (agilizando assim o processo de boot e eliminando demais dependências), como também buscar por uma edição que seja mais atual ao que é encontrado para seu modelo no Brasil.

Antes de começarmos, entretanto, é preciso destacarmos que o procedimento deve ser realizado por sua própria conta e risco, já que problemas podem ser encontrados caso algum passo não seja executado corretamente, danificando então o seu dispositivo. Além disso, reinstalar o firmware fará com que todos os dados do aparelho sejam apagados, logo é recomendado um backup completo de seus dados e arquivos antes de continuar. Por último, leia completamente o tutorial antes de continuar, para que assim possa ter uma ideia melhor se pretende passar por todo o processo para instalar um novo firmware.


Pré-requisitos

  • Um cabo USB compatível com seu dispositivo Lumia para conectá-lo ao computador
  • Um computador com Windows 7 ou mais recente e ao menos 4GB de armazenamento disponível
  • Um dispositivo Lumia com Windows Phone 8 ou mais recente
  • Código de produto do seu dispositivo, que pode ser acessado em configurações > extras > informações avançadas, contando com o padrão RM-XXXX

Arquivos necessários

Iniciando o processo

A primeira coisa a ser feita é instalar o Windows Device Recovery Tool, já que será por meio da ferramenta da Microsoft que a alteração do firmware poderá ser feita de maneira tão facilitada. Após baixar o arquivo no link acima, basta executar o instalador e aceitar os termos da companhia, aguardando então até que todo o procedimento seja concluído.

Baixando o firmware


Ao abrir o link relacionado ao download do firmware de seu dispositivo, você verá a tela acima, onde na lateral esquerda é exibida uma lista com todos os modelos suportados pela ferramenta. Para agilizar o processo de busca, aperte o conjunto de teclas CTRL + F para utilizar a função "Localizar" do navegador e digite o código do produto relacionado ao seu dispositivo, clicando então sobre ele quando o identificar na lista.

Como em nosso teste foi utilizado um Lumia 930, procuramos pelo código de produto RM-1045.


Após clicar no modelo desejado será aberta a tela acima, onde são listados todos os firmwares disponíveis para aquele aparelho. Neste ponto, é muito importante prestar atenção em qual arquivo está sendo selecionado, pois caso contrário você poderá danificar funções de seu smartphone, principalmente relacionadas às redes móveis. Para que o firmware funcione corretamente no Brasil, é recomentado que você baixe a versão "Global" ou a "LTA BR CV", sendo esta última uma sigla para América Latina, Brasil, Country Variant, ou seja, uma versão sem vínculo com operadoras.

Novamente, é possível que você utilize a função "Localizar" do navegador para agilizar o processo de busca, bastando então clicar sobre a opção desejada e seguir ao próximo passo.


Em nosso teste, foi escolhida a versão "RM-1045 VAR LTA BR CV BLACK", que corresponde ao Lumia 930 na cor preta vendido no Brasil sem vínculo com operadoras, sendo destacado que a versão mais recente disponível para a variante escolhida é a de número 02540.00019.15236.54008. Vale notar que até mesmo a cor do aparelho é utilizada na descrição de sua firmware, porém não foi possível notarmos qualquer diferença entre as firmwares que fosse baseada neste fator.

Após clicar no link destacado em vermelho na imagem acima, será aberta uma lista com vários outros links, sendo necessário baixar apenas o arquivo cuja extensão é ".ffu". O download varia de acordo com o dispositivo, porém em média possui entre 1 e 3GB, bastando então que você crie uma pasta chamada "Package" na tela inicial de seu computador e o mova para ela.


Instalando o firmware

  • Conecte seu dispositivo ao computador por meio do cabo USB
  • Abra o prompt de comando como administrador (botão direito do mouse > executar como Administrador)
  • Copie o comando abaixo e cole no prompt de acordo com a versão de seu sistema operacional (x86 ou x64)
    • Windows x86 - cd "%ProgramFiles%\Microsoft Care Suite\Windows Device Recovery Tool"
    • Windows x64 - cd "%ProgramFiles(x86)%\Microsoft Care Suite\Windows Device Recovery Tool"
  • Aperte ENTER para executar o comando
  • Copie a linha abaixo e modifique o "x" para o nome do arquivo .ffu baixado anteriormente
    • thor2 -mode uefiflash -ffufile "%HomePath%\Desktop\Package\x.ffu" -do_full_nvi_update -do_factory_reset -reboot
  • Após modificar o nome corretamente, aperte ENTER para que o comando seja executado
  • Não remova seu smartphone do computador durante o processo de instalação, caso contrário o arquivo poderá ser corrompido
  • Pronto! Seu dispositivo irá reiniciar e então ele estará como novo

Vale lembrar que a reinstalação do firmware reseta completamente seu aparelho aos padrões de fábrica. Infelizmente, como ainda não temos firmware baseada no Windows 10 Mobile para nenhum dos Lumias de gerações X20, X30 ou X40, seu dispositivo estará com o Windows Phone 8.1 ao final do processo, sendo então necessário atualizá-lo.

E ai, o que achou do tutorial? Conseguiu reinstalar o firmware de seu Lumia corretamente? Enfrentou algum problema durante o processo? Deixe-nos seu comentário abaixo!


36

Comentários

Use o Windows Device Recovery Tool para reinstalar manualmente o firmware de seu Lumia [tutorial]
  • So pra deixá-los informados.A Microsoft encerrou o suporte ao WindowsDeviceRecoveryTools esta semana agora em Junho de 2022.Agora pra recuperar o Lumia, terá que baixar a ROM no LumiaFrimware e usar o Windows Phone Internals.

      • Fiz Procedimento para tentar instalar Windows 10 no Lumia - No programa Windows Internals quase todo procedimento deu certo até chegar no Flashing bootloader unloncked travou e agora meu Pc não reconhece o celular e o Lumia não liga. Como faço para voltar. Verifiquei em todos tutoriais e naõ houve nenhuma solução e Windows Device recovery notifica procedimento botal ligar e botao diminuir volume ate vibrar mas nada adiantou.

          • Está dando erro de escrita,"THOR2_ERROR_NO_DEVICE_WITHIN_TIMEOUT"

              • Que adianta perguntar aqui se ninguém responde??

                  • o meu ta dando esse erro!!


                    Microsoft Windows
                    Copyright (c) 2009 Microsoft Corporation. Todos os direitos reservados.

                    C:\Users\Amanda>cd "%ProgramFiles%\Microsoft Care Suite\Windows Device Recovery
                    Tool"

                    C:\Program Files\Microsoft Care Suite\Windows Device Recovery Tool>thor2 -mode u
                    efiflash -ffufile "%HomePath%\Desktop\Package\RM1020_02074.00000.152 34.28002_RET
                    AIL_prod_signed_1004_026F59_VIV-BR.ffu" -do_full_nvi_update -do_factory_reset -r
                    eboot
                    THOR2 1.8.2.18
                    Built for Windows @ 13:36:46 Jun 16 2015
                    Thor2 is running on Windows of version 6.1
                    thor2 -mode uefiflash -ffufile \Users\Amanda\Desktop\Package\RM1020_02074.00000.
                    15234.28002_RETAIL_prod_signed_1004_026F59_VIV-BR.ffu -do_full_nvi_update -do_fa
                    ctory_reset -reboot
                    Process started Tue Jul 31 16:15:44 2018
                    Logging to file C:\Users\Amanda\AppData\Local\Temp\thor2_win_20180 731161544_Thre
                    adId-4592.log
                    Debugging enabled for uefiflash

                    Initiating FFU flash operation
                    WinUSB in use.
                    isDeviceInNcsdMode
                    isDeviceInNcsdMode is false
                    Device mode 6 Uefi mode
                    Pre-programming operations
                    Disable timeouts
                    Get flashing parameters
                    Lumia Flash detected
                    Protocol version 2.34 Implementation version 2.59
                    Size of one transfer is 2363392
                    MMOS RAM support: 1
                    Size of buffer is 2359296
                    Number of eMMC sectors: 7634944
                    Platform ID of device: Nokia.MSM8212.P6134.1.1
                    Async protocol version: 01
                    Security info:
                    Platform secure boot enabled
                    Secure FFU enabled
                    JTAG eFuse blown
                    RDC not found
                    Authentication not done
                    UEFI secure boot enabled
                    SHK enabled
                    Device supports FFU protocols: 0015
                    Subblock ID 32
                    Device programming started
                    Using secure flash method
                    CoreProgrammer version 2015.06.10.001.
                    Start programming signed ffu file \Users\Amanda\Desktop\Package\RM1020_02074.000
                    00.15234.28002_RETAIL_prod_signed_1004_026F59_VIV-BR.ffu
                    FfuReader version is 2015061501
                    Send FlashApp write parameter: 0x4d544f00
                    Perform handshake with UEFI...
                    Flash app: Protocol Version 2.34 Implementation Version 2.59
                    Unknown sub block detected. Skip...
                    DevicePlatformInfo: Nokia.MSM8212.P6134.1.1
                    Unknown sub block detected. Skip...
                    Unknown sub block detected. Skip...
                    Supported protocol versions bitmap is 15
                    Secure FFU sync version 1 supported.
                    Secure FFU async version 1 supported.
                    Secure FFU sync version 2 supported.
                    Secure FFU async version 2 supported.
                    CRC header v. 1
                    CRC align bytes. 4
                    Get CID of the device...
                    Get EMMC size of the device...
                    Emmc size in sectors: 7634944
                    CID: Samsung, Size 3728 MB
                    Start charging...
                    Start charging... DONE. Status = 0
                    ConnSpeedEcho: Elapsed= 0.512000, EchoSpeed= 13.18, Transferred= 7077918 bytes
                    Get security Status...
                    Security Status:
                    Platform secure boot is enabled.
                    Secure eFUSE is enabled.
                    JTAG is disabled.
                    RDC is missing from the device.
                    Authentication is not done.
                    UEFI secure boot is enabled.
                    Secondary HW key exists.
                    Get RKH of the device...
                    RKH of the device is 6DF7F89E7A01F5B5DCB54754545B30B8B036C6BD294ACE42C8 B34A7D504
                    D6183
                    Get ISSW Version...
                    ISSW Version: 223
                    Mon Jan 12 15:51:37 EET 2015 ;ISSW v0223; rg1; OS; DNE; KCI 1283; ASIC 8x12;
                    Get system memory size...
                    Size of system mem: 524288 KB
                    Read antitheft status...
                    Requested read param 0x41545250 is not supported by this flash app version.
                    Send backup to RAM req...
                    Clearing the backup GPT...SKIPPED!
                    Successfully parsed FFU file. Header size: 0x000c0000, Payload size: 0x000000005
                    1ec0000, Chunk size: 0x00020000, Header offset: 0x00000000, Payload offset: 0x00
                    000000000c0000
                    RKH match between device and FFU file!
                    Option: Skip CRC32 check in use
                    Start sending header data...
                    Start sending payload data V2Sbl in async mode...
                    Percents: 0
                    Percents: 1
                    Percents: 2
                    Percents: 3
                    Percents: 4
                    Percents: 5
                    Percents: 6
                    Percents: 7
                    Percents: 8
                    Percents: 9
                    Percents: 10
                    FlashApp returned reported error in SecureFlashResp! Status: 0x0004, Specifier:
                    0x80000007
                    lastDescriptorIndex: 1025 lastLocationIndex: 0
                    Retrying from index 1026
                    Percents: 9
                    FlashApp returned reported error in SecureFlashResp! Status: 0x0004, Specifier:
                    0x80000007
                    lastDescriptorIndex: 1025 lastLocationIndex: 0
                    Retrying from index 1026
                    No more retries. Exit flashing!
                    UEFI returned error: 0xfa000004
                    Exception during programming: 393220
                    Safe write descriptor index reached: true
                    Payload data transfer speed (4.86 MB/s) Elapsed time 28.69 sec
                    Payload data size 139.501892 MB
                    programSecureFfuFile. Closing \Users\Amanda\Desktop\Package\RM1020_02074.00
                    000.15234.28002_RETAIL_prod_signed_1004_026F59_VIV-BR.ffu
                    programming operation failed!
                    Rebooting device
                    Sending reset command to device
                    Reset command sent successfully.
                    Operation took about 40.00 seconds. Average transfer speed was 3.48 MB/s.

                    THOR2_ERROR_FA_ERR_WRITE_FAIL

                    THOR2 1.8.2.18 exited with error code 393220 (0x60004)

                    C:\Program Files\Microsoft Care Suite\Windows Device Recovery Tool>

                      • A instalação do "Windows device recovery tool" no meu computador não ira eliminar ou alterar alguma coisa no meu computador?

                          • Parabéns pelo tutorial funcionou perfeitamente.lumia 532.

                              • o meu foi bloqueado pela operadora. pensei que o procedimento me ajudaria nessa... não deu.

                                  • O procedimento para o comando prompt não funciona, da a mensagem de: " A sintese do nome do arquivo, do nome do diretorio ou do rotulo do volume esta incorreto"
                                    ja fiz varias mudanças mas não reconhece o procedimento.

                                      • Graças a Deus. Meu aparelho entrou numa repetição infinita durante uma atualização AUTOMÁTICA. Não dava hard reset. Esse post salvou o aparelho. O processo foi fácil e rápido. Obrigado pessoal.

                                          • VC INSTALOU O W10 E FICOU RUIM, POR ISSO USOU ESSE TUTORIAL PRA VOLTAR AO 8.1?

                                            PRECISO FAZER ISSO MAS O WINDOWS DEVICE RECOVERY TOOL NÃO CONECTA... DÁ ERRO DE PROXY SEMPRE.

                                            Então fazendo esse tutorial posso voltar ao Lumia Denin que estava original?

                                              • Tenho um Lumia 640xl Dual Sim 3G. É possível instalar a firmware do 4G ? Ele funcionará como 4G ?

                                                  • essa clicket desbloqueia para operadora da oi?

                                                      • nossaaaaaa muito obrigado, melhor tutorial 1000%, achei que não tinha mais jeito foi nos 45' do segundo tempo .... Meu muito Obrigado !!!

                                                          • eu tentei varias vezes mas da falha na instalação, alguem sabe algum outro meio de instalar o firmware?

                                                              • Tentei de varias maneiras e sempre da erro logo apos verificação de proteção meu Lumia é 640 LTE operadora cricket

                                                                  • Instalei conforme tutorial, mas o meu 435 só fica reiniciando... fica por uns 40 segundos e não me deixa concluir configurações de wifi, data, hora!!

                                                                      • MEU NOKIA LUMIA 830 TA TRAVADO MODO AVIÃO, FIZ PROCEDIMENTO FUNCIONOU, MAS REINICIOU VOLTOU O PROBLEMA TENSO

                                                                          • Muito obrigado pela ajuda, eu atualizei o meu da marca clicket para preview do Windows 10 e deu erro, graças a vocês do site eu consegui arrumar ele.

                                                                              • Tenho um 640 LTE RM-1073 da operadora CRICKET. Qual versão devo baixar para deixar ele com o sistema limpo?

                                                                                • no meu 830 sem jeito. ele reinicia no nokia e depois o logo do win e reinicia

                                                                                    • Alguém pode me ajudar???

                                                                                        • Você conseguiu ressuscitar seu celular? Estou com um Lumia 1020 com esses mesmo erro.

                                                                                            • Parabéns pelo tutorial funcionou perfeitamente.

                                                                                                • Instalei o 8.1 Denim no meu 1320. Por incrível que pareça ficou melhor, mais fluído. E o Here funciona. Enquanto o W10M nao ficar decente vou ficando com o 8.1

                                                                                                    • Queria resolver o meu problema com meu 630 queria a última versão do Windows 10 na prévia, que foi disponível para ele quando estava na faze de teste.. Antes de te sid cancelado

                                                                                                        • segui todos os passos e deu certo agora tenho meu lumia 625 desvinculado de operadora, obrigado pelo post bom trabalho..

                                                                                                            • Não irei voltar para o 8.1 mesmo

                                                                                                                • Eh mais fácil verificar qual firmware correta o aparelho antes de instalar. O código se encontra na parte traseira do aparelho. Perto ou abaixo da bateria.

                                                                                                                    • Não entendi, pra que serve essa instalação do Firmware?
                                                                                                                      Se o meu firmware ainda é o mesmo que está como mais recente nessa lista, qual seria a vantagem seu eu reinstalasse?

                                                                                                                        • Nao teria, a menos que seu aparelho seja vinculado com alguma operadora, pois nesse caso nao apareceria mais a logomarca dela na tela de boot, além de tirar restriçoes com relação a updates futuros.

                                                                                                                          • Show de bola!

                                                                                                                              • Sera que com isso consigo ressucitar um lumia 625, que morreu com a msg "unable to find a bootable opition, Please press any key to shut down" Algo parecido com isso. Procurei pela net como resolver e pelo que vi so trocando a placa mae, o que esta fora de cogitação pelo preço. Espero que isso resolva meu problema agora.

                                                                                                                                  • Vou fazer no meu Lumia 1320 que está com SO versão Costa Rica.

                                                                                                                                      LG Gram Style: um notebook premium e bonito por fora, mas... | Vídeo Hands-on 

                                                                                                                                      Confira destaques da nova Atualização de Abril do Windows 10 e saiba como instalar